Tree Felling

Tree felling is the process of intentionally cutting down a tree, typically for various reasons such as safety, land development, or tree health. It involves carefully planning and executing the removal of a tree from its standing position. Professional tree fellers use specialized tools and techniques to ensure the tree is safely brought down, minimizing any potential risks or damage to surrounding structures or landscapes. Tree felling requires expertise and knowledge of tree anatomy, cutting techniques, and safety protocols to ensure a smooth and controlled removal process.

Cutting

Tree cutting refers to the practice of selectively removing specific branches or sections from a tree. It is typically done to enhance the tree’s health, shape, or overall appearance. Tree cutting involves carefully identifying and assessing the branches that need to be removed, taking into consideration factors such as dead or diseased limbs, crossing or rubbing branches, or those that pose a risk to structures or people. Professional tree cutters use specialized tools such as pruning saws, shears, and pole pruners to make precise and strategic cuts. By removing specific branches, tree cutting promotes better air circulation, sunlight penetration, and overall tree growth. It also helps maintain the structural integrity of the tree and can prevent potential hazards caused by weak or overgrown branches. Tree cutting is performed with great care and expertise to ensure the tree’s health and aesthetics are enhanced while minimizing any negative impacts.

Palm Trimming

Palm trimming refers to the process of maintaining and shaping palm trees through the removal of specific fronds or branches. It is done to enhance the tree’s appearance, promote healthy growth, and prevent potential hazards. Palm trees have unique pruning requirements, and professional palm trimmers possess the knowledge and expertise to perform this task effectively. Palm trimming involves identifying dead, damaged, or diseased fronds and removing them to improve the tree’s overall health and aesthetics. Additionally, overgrown or obstructive fronds that may pose a risk to nearby structures or individuals are selectively pruned. This process requires specialized tools such as pruning saws, loppers, and palm shears to carefully remove unwanted fronds without causing harm to the tree. By regularly trimming palms, the tree’s structural integrity is maintained, allowing it to grow and thrive. Palm trimming also enhances the tree’s appearance, ensuring a neat and visually appealing landscape. Professional palm trimmers have the necessary skills and experience to provide precise and efficient palm trimming services while prioritizing the tree’s health and safety.

Branch Removal

Branch removal is the practice of selectively cutting and removing specific branches from a tree. It is performed for various reasons, including tree health, safety, and aesthetics. Branch removal involves carefully identifying branches that are dead, diseased, damaged, or posing a risk to structures or people. Professional arborists assess the tree’s structure and health to determine which branches should be removed. Specialized tools such as pruning saws, shears, and loppers are used to make clean and precise cuts. By removing problem branches, the overall health of the tree can be improved, promoting better airflow, sunlight penetration, and growth. Branch removal also helps to prevent potential hazards, such as branches that are rubbing against each other, crossing, or weakened due to disease or decay. Additionally, selective branch removal can enhance the tree’s shape and appearance, creating a more aesthetically pleasing landscape. Proper techniques and safety measures are employed to ensure the tree’s well-being during the branch removal process. Professional arborists possess the expertise and knowledge to perform branch removal with care and precision, ensuring the tree’s health, safety, and overall beauty are enhanced.

Pruning

Pruning is a unique Tree pruning is the practice of selectively trimming and shaping a tree to improve its health, structure, and aesthetics. It involves the removal of specific branches, buds, or roots to achieve desired outcomes. Tree pruning is typically done by professional arborists who possess the expertise and knowledge of tree anatomy, growth patterns, and pruning techniques.
The primary goals of tree pruning are to promote healthy growth, enhance the tree’s appearance, and ensure the safety of surrounding structures and people. Pruning can involve various techniques, such as crown thinning, crown raising, and crown reduction. Crown thinning involves selectively removing branches to reduce the tree’s density, allowing better air circulation and sunlight penetration. Crown raising focuses on removing lower branches to create clearance above the ground or structures. Crown reduction entails reducing the overall size of the tree by selectively removing branches while maintaining its natural shape.
Tree pruning also involves the removal of dead, diseased, or damaged branches to prevent further decay or infestation. By removing these branches, the tree’s overall health is improved, and potential safety hazards are minimized. Pruning cuts are made using specialized tools, such as pruning shears, loppers, and pruning saws, to ensure clean and precise cuts that promote proper healing.
Proper timing and techniques are crucial in tree pruning to avoid unnecessary stress and damage to the tree. Professional arborists consider factors such as tree species, growth habits, seasonal considerations, and the specific objectives of the pruning before executing the pruning plan.
Overall, tree pruning is a skilled practice that aims to enhance the health, structure, and appearance of trees while maintaining their safety. Professional arborists employ their expertise to perform tree pruning with precision, ensuring the long-term vitality and beauty of the tree.

Stump Removal

Stump removal is the process of completely extracting the remaining portion of a tree stump and its root system from the ground after a tree has been cut down. It is typically performed using specialized equipment and techniques to ensure efficient and thorough removal.
Stump removal serves several purposes, including eliminating tripping hazards, preventing the regrowth of the tree, reclaiming land for construction or landscaping, and enhancing the aesthetics of the surrounding area. Professional stump removal involves the use of stump grinders, which are powerful machines equipped with rotating cutting discs. These discs gradually chip away at the stump and its roots, turning them into small wood chips or sawdust.
During the stump removal process, the stump grinder is carefully maneuvered around the stump, grinding away the wood incrementally until the entire stump is below ground level. The depth of grinding can vary based on the desired outcome, such as if you plan to plant another tree in the same location or create a level surface.
Once the stump and its roots are ground down, the remaining wood chips and debris are typically used to fill the hole left by the stump, or they can be removed from the site upon request. In some cases, stump grinding may not completely eradicate the stump’s roots, but it significantly reduces their size and hinders their ability to regrow.
Professional stump removal services ensure that the process is conducted safely and efficiently, with consideration for surrounding structures, underground utilities, and other potential obstacles. Stump removal experts have the knowledge and experience to handle various types and sizes of stumps, employing the appropriate equipment and techniques for each job.
